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Область применения:
Databricks Runtime 18.1 и выше
Вычисляет пересечение набора двух двоичных представлений TupleSketch с двойными сводками.
Синтаксис
tuple_intersection_double ( first, second [, mode ] )
Аргументы
- во-первых: TupleSketch в двоичном формате с двойными сводками.
- во-вторых: TupleSketch в двоичном формате с двойными сводками.
-
режим: необязательный
STRINGлитерал, указывающий режим агрегирования. Допустимые значения:'sum','min','max','alwaysone'. Значение по умолчанию —'sum'.
Возвраты
BINARY Значение, содержащее TupleSketch, представляющее пересечение.
Примечания.
- Результат содержит только ключи, которые отображаются в обоих входных эскизах.
- Для взаимодействия более двух эскизов используйте tuple_intersection_agg_double.
Сообщения об ошибках
Примеры
> SELECT tuple_sketch_estimate_double(
tuple_intersection_double(
tuple_sketch_agg_double(col1, val1),
tuple_sketch_agg_double(col2, val2)
)
) FROM VALUES (1, 1.0D, 1, 4.0D), (2, 2.0D, 2, 5.0D), (3, 3.0D, 4, 6.0D) tab(col1, val1, col2, val2);
2.0